Speech-Language Pathologist Hourly Pay in Kansas City, MO: $43.05 (2026)
Quick Answer:Hourly pay for a speech-language pathologist working in Kansas City, MO runs $43.05 at the median for 2026 — annualizing to $89,556 at a standard 2,080-hour year. Figures projected from BLS OEWS 2025 (SOC 29-1127). Weighted against Kansas City's regional price level (BEA RPP 92.5, 7% below national), each hour of work buys what $46.52 nationally would. A 24-hour part-time schedule grosses $53,729 per year.

In Kansas City, Missouri, the median hourly pay for a speech-language pathologist is projected to be $43.05 in 2026, which is significantly lower than the national hourly median of $48.93. This hourly rate opens various opportunities for part-time professionals and per-diem workers, who can practice in an array of settings including school therapy rooms, hospital environments for bedside dysphagia evaluations, outpatient clinics, and telepractice sessions. For those embarking on their careers, entry-level positions can start at $29.69 per hour, while experienced SLPs may earn as much as $59.16 per hour. This official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) data reflects both the diversity of job settings in Kansas City and the varying pay scales that come with experience and specialization.
Speech-Language Pathologist Hourly Wage Breakdown
| Percentile | Hourly Rate | Per 8hr Shift |
|---|---|---|
| Entry Level (P10) | $29.69 | $237.51 |
| Lower Range (P25) | $36.56 | $292.50 |
| Median (P50) | $43.05 | $344.41 |
| Upper Range (P75) | $51.63 | $413.05 |
| Top Earners (P90) | $59.16 | $473.28 |

Hourly Rate Trajectory for Speech-Language Pathologists in Kansas City (2019–2027)
2019–2025: actual BLS OEWS data for this metro area. 2026+: CAGR 3.99% projection.
| Year | Hourly Rate | Status |
|---|---|---|
| 2019 | $35.89/hr | Actual |
| 2020 | $37.74/hr | Actual |
| 2021 | $37.82/hr | Actual |
| 2022 | $36.32/hr | Actual |
| 2023 | $37.67/hr | Actual |
| 2024 | $40.53/hr | Actual |
| 2025 | $41.40/hr | Actual |
| 2026(current) | $43.05/hr | Estimated |
| 2027 | $44.77/hr | Projected |
Based on 7 years of B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, the median hourly rate for speech-language pathologists in Kansas City grew 15.4% from $35.89/hr (2019) to $41.40/hr (2025). At a 3.99% projected growth rate, hourly pay is expected to reach $44.77/hr by 2027. Working as an Hourly Speech-Language Pathologist in Kansas City
The earning potential for part-time speech-language pathologists working three days per week can translate to a considerable income while allowing for flexibility. For instance, a part-time SLP working 24 hours weekly can expect to take home around $53,000 annually, a stark contrast to full-time counterparts who might earn over $89,000. Per-diem and agency speech-language pathologists can command higher rates, often billing between $50 and $75 per hour, while specialized medical SLPs might hit rates as high as $110 per hour in cash practices. The variety in compensation across different employer types in Kansas City—ranging from school districts, which hire about 55% of SLPs, to hospitals and skilled nursing facilities—reflects both demand and the nature of services provided. Some professionals may choose lower hourly rates for the benefits of health insurance; meanwhile, negotiation skills become essential for those seeking positions in this competitive field. With telepractice rising dramatically post-2020, knowing how to structure contracts effectively can enhance earnings and opportunities for current and aspiring SLPs in Kansas City, MO.
